Do I Have Alkaline Soil?

Essential for gardening, soil knowledge is key. Before you begin to choose plants, discover what kind of ground lies beneath. Sandy, silt, clay or peat, or perhaps a mix of two – loam soils are best. Alkalinity may lurk in chalky and clay soils.

Visual cues can hint at pH levels; tests are recommended. Look for white lumps of limestone in beds – evidence of alkaline soil? A tester kit purchased at most retailers will reveal the answer.

Soil’s content and composition vary greatly by location. Knowing what your native soil contains affords an advantage before seeking advice on how to improve it either chemically or organically with compost and mulch materials.

Diagnosing and understanding the signs provided by nature assists in creating a balanced and healthy growing environment that nourishes all types of species, from flowers to vegetables alike! Taking time to understand your soil leads to bounty harvests long-term; it is well worth the effort!

Alkaline soil is indicated if pH falls between 7.1 and 8.0.

Testing your soil’s pH is essential if you wish to maximize plant growth. An easy and inexpensive way is with an at-home tester kit. Alternatively, add some of the soil to a jar of vinegar; if it foams, it likely has a high alkalinity level.

Signs observed in your garden or nearby gardens can inform you about soil acidity as well – what does well in similar conditions may do well for you. Furthermore, research on the particular region may provide further information about local soils. All this can help determine optimum pH levels for optimal plant health.

What Causes Alkaline Soil?

Grounds rich in calcium carbonate and calcium bicarbonate, formed by natural weathering, typically hold highly alkaline soil. Yet, altered surroundings can create intense pH levels.

Factors like excessive irrigation or inadequate drainage can lead to an increase in bicarbonates, resulting in rapid soil alkalization. Similarly, the addition of chemicals like lime and overwhelming quantities of fertilizers culminated in dangerously high pH levels.

Fortifying the soil not only restores neutrality but also allows essential nutrients to reach the roots of flora, fostering deeper plant growth and promoting rich vegetation.

Causes of Alkaline Soil Caused by Human Activity

  1. Overuse of chemical fertilizers and pesticides
  2. Industrial activities and emissions
  3. Irrigation with poor-quality water
  4. Improper disposal of alkaline waste materials
  5. Deforestation and land-use changes
  6. Overgrazing by livestock
  7. Urbanization and construction activities disrupt the soil’s natural structure.

Regardless of the origin, it’s essential to recognize the risks associated with high-pH soils before planting. In places where rainfall is low, and temperatures are consistently warm, impacted soil can be very common due to accumulated chemicals and salts. The Pros and Cons of Alkaline Soil

Pros:

  • Alkaline soil typically contains higher levels of essential nutrients like calcium, magnesium, and potassium.
  • It is less prone to leaching, which means that nutrients are more readily available to plants.
  • Alkaline soil can help to reduce the effects of certain plant diseases, such as clubroot in brassicas.
  • It can support the growth of plants that prefer a high pH level, such as some ornamental flowers and vegetables like beets, broccoli, and cauliflower.

Cons:

  • Alkaline soil can limit the availability of certain micronutrients like iron, zinc, and manganese, which are essential for plant growth.
  • It can cause chlorosis, a yellowing of the leaves, in plants that prefer acidic soil.
  • Alkaline soil can increase the solubility of some toxic elements like lead, which can be harmful to both plants and humans.
  • It can also reduce the effectiveness of some herbicides and pesticides, making it more difficult to control weeds and pests.

Should I Amend My Alkaline Soil?

Soil pH matters. Unless your soil is highly alkaline, it’s better to accept the natural limitations and cultivate crops suited to the local environment. Mildly alkaline soil can even deliver a benefit – so avoid major amendments.

Focus on other defining factors, such as poor water or nutrient retention, then improve soils through organic additions. Gradual pH changes will accumulate over time.

Unless absolutely necessary, don’t opt for synthetic acidifiers like aluminum sulfate or ammonium nitrate – these are not ideal in organic gardens. Instead, reach for mulches like pine needles; a heavy application can achieve acidic effects.

Know what you have before attempting to make major adjustments, balance values against risks, and aim for natural solutions when possible.

The Best Trees for Alkaline Soil

Blackthorn

Crafting a garden designed to thrive in alkaline soil requires foresight. Begin with the largest plants, such as trees, both large and small, which can fit into almost any space. Strategically map a layout with room for roots to grow and spread out over time.

Explore native trees that are best suited to your climate and more drought-resistant species that lower water costs. Plant natural homes for wildlife like birds and insects while also providing shade, privacy, and year-round visual interest.

Additionally, plan ahead by researching annuals, perennials, shrubs, bulbs, and ornamental grasses – all of which emphasize texture, depth, and contrast to create an effective framework for garden-scaping success. Together these components build recognition of distinct themes in your locale. Enjoy thoughtful hues from seasonal blooms inspired by the colors all around you!

  • Blackthorn: a small deciduous tree with white flowers and edible fruit.
  • Cotoneaster Frigida: a hardy evergreen shrub with small white or pink flowers and red berries.
  • Field Maple: a small deciduous tree with lobed leaves that turn yellow in the fall.
  • Hawthorn: a small, thorny tree with white or pink flowers and red berries that attract birds.
  • Holm Oak: an evergreen tree with glossy leaves that is drought-tolerant and can live for hundreds of years.
  • Montezuma Pine: a fast-growing evergreen tree with long needles that is native to Mexico and Central America.
  • Spindle: a small deciduous tree with pink or white flowers and bright pink fruit.
  • Sorbus alnifolia: a small tree with white flowers and red or yellow berries that is native to China and Korea.
  • Strawberry Tree: an evergreen tree with small white or pink flowers and red berries that taste like a cross between a strawberry and a fig.
  • Yew: an evergreen tree with dark green needles and red berries that are toxic to humans and animals.

The Best Shrubs for Alkaline Soil

Buddleia

Shrubs and bushes provide beauty and texture in the garden. They not only create a decorative edge bed or border but also subtle layers of planting beneath trees.

For an area with alkaline soil, some excellent shrub options include sweet bay (Laurus nobilis), Japanese holly (Ilex crenata), juniper (Juniperus procumbens), and rhododendron (Rhododendron spp.). These low-maintenance plants are loved for their hardiness and ability to thrive in both sun and shade. For a stunning, colorful accent, try butterfly bush (Buddleia davidii), penta lantana (Lantana camara), or creeping phlox (Phlox subulata).

For even more variety and contrast, consider mixing evergreen shrubs like boxwood (Buxus sempervirens) or dwarf yaupon holly (Ilex vomitoria ‘Nana’). Ornamental grasses can create movement, contrast, and wonderful textures, too – try mondo grass (Ophiopogon japonicus) or Pennisetum orientalis.

  • Buddleia: a deciduous shrub with fragrant flower spikes that attract butterflies and bees.
  • Deutzia ‘Pride of Rochester’: a deciduous shrub with pink or white flowers that bloom in the spring.
  • Forsythia: a deciduous shrub with bright yellow flowers that bloom in early spring.
  • Hydrangea: a deciduous shrub with large, showy flowers that can change color based on soil pH.
  • Lilac: a deciduous shrub with fragrant flowers that bloom in the spring.
  • Osmanthus: an evergreen shrub with small, fragrant flowers that bloom in the fall.
  • Philadelphus: a deciduous shrub with white or cream-colored flowers that have a sweet scent.
  • Santolina chamaecyparissus: an evergreen shrub with small, aromatic leaves and yellow flowers.
  • Viburnum opulus: a deciduous shrub with white or pink flowers and bright red berries that attract birds.
  • Weigela: a deciduous shrub with trumpet-shaped flowers that bloom in the spring and summer.

The Best Edible Plants for Alkaline Soil

Asparagus

Alkaline soils are often challenging when it comes to fruit and vegetable gardening – they can be too high in pH for many crops. Fortunately, several types of plants thrive in this soil type, including brassicas, legumes, and desert herbs.

Cabbage family members, such as broccoli and Brussels sprouts, benefit from soils with a high pH. Alkaline conditions reduce the risk of club root disease for these essential veggies. Other top picks for alkaline ground include parsley, peas, and dill.

  • Asparagus: a perennial vegetable that produces tender shoots in the spring.
  • Broccoli/Brussels Sprouts: cool-season vegetables that produce nutrient-rich, edible buds.
  • Cabbages: a hardy vegetable with a variety of culinary uses that can be grown in a range of colors.
  • Kale/Collard Greens: leafy greens that are packed with nutrients and can be eaten raw or cooked.
  • Leeks: a member of the onion family with a mild, sweet flavor that can be used in soups, stews, and other dishes.
  • Marjoram: a perennial herb with a sweet, slightly minty flavor that is commonly used in Mediterranean and Middle Eastern cuisine.
  • Peas: cool-season legumes that can be eaten fresh or dried and are a good source of protein and fiber.
  • Pole Beans: a type of bean that grows on vines and can produce a high yield in a small space.
  • Rosemary: a woody, perennial herb with an aromatic flavor that is commonly used in Mediterranean cuisine.
  • Thyme: a versatile, perennial herb with a pungent flavor that is commonly used in soups, stews, and marinades.

The Best Flowers for Alkaline Soil

Blooms bring beauty to the garden beyond their aesthetic value. Plants in the herbaceous layer provide food for pollinators and beneficial insects alike. Carefully select flowers that are suited to your soil’s pH level; many options offer stunning hues to compliment your garden’s overall design.

Good flowers for alkaline soil include asters, coneflowers, gaillardias, salvias, and painted daisies designed to thrive in such conditions. Native wildflowers also flourish here, providing much-needed nectar for declining insect populations, such as butterflies and bees. When well-considered planting is done, your lower layer will positively impact not only lookers but entire ecosystems.

  • Anchusa: A showy blue wildflower that prefers well-drained soils.
  • Borage: A pretty blue flowering herb that adapts well to alkaline soil.
  • California Poppies: A drought-tolerant wildflower that thrives in poor, well-drained soil.
  • Lavender: A fragrant herb that grows well in alkaline soil with good drainage.
  • Lily of the Valley: A shade-loving perennial that prefers moist but well-draining soil.
  • Phacelia: A hardy wildflower that prefers dry, rocky soils and attracts pollinators.
  • Polemoniums: A low-maintenance perennial that tolerates alkaline soil and light shade.
  • Trifolium (Clovers): A legume that grows well in alkaline soil and enriches the soil with nitrogen.
  • Viper’s Bugloss: A striking blue wildflower that thrives in dry, alkaline soil.
  • Wild Marjoram: A fragrant herb that prefers well-draining soil and tolerates alkaline conditions.
